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
SquidClamav versions 5.x through 5.7
SquidClamav versions 6.x through 6.6
Description
The issue arises from the squidclamav check preview handler function in squidclamav.c, which passes an unescaped URL to a system command call. This all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service, resulting in a daemon crash, by using a URL containing certain characters, such as %0D or %0A.
Recommendations
For SquidClamav versions 5.x through 5.7, update to version 5.8 or later.
For SquidClamav versions 6.x through 6.6, update to version 6.7 or later.
